Virtualization in the Development Process Virtualization means the execution of development steps within a partially or completely simulated environment. Core to virtualization are models (functions, plant, driver, environment) and their management, e.g. variants, IP protection, traceability Virtualization has to master the combination of modeling, integration, and simulation based on standards 8 Public ETAS 2013-06-24 ETAS GmbH 2013. AUTOSAR and FMI Relevant standards: 1. AUTOSAR Software components and their communication ( controller ) in and between ECUs (Electronic Control Units) 2. Functional Mockup Interface (FMI) Embedding controls in the system AUTOSAR and FMI are independent from each other complement each other Avoid coupling of plant and controls via AUTOSAR 9 Public ETAS 2013-06-24 ETAS GmbH 2013. Solution Examples Functional Mockup Interface Standard (FMI) Exchange and co-simulation of models Modelica Association Project Validation via several proof of concept applications Supported by different tool vendors Free access to the specification, including examples www.fmi-standard.org FMI is the only open accessable interface to connect plant and control 12 Public ETAS 2013-06-24 ETAS GmbH 2013.
